Output 4a1650662a21219218f798c4567fbf74953038ec89c5ca56f48049674e21bb55:0

value
997460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a015e8b1da74f8dcecfd06bf88e120060599b1d OP_EQUAL
address
3BMXC24aX9X4aJTEg3ymtRGykFUmyLYCG1
transaction
4a1650662a21219218f798c4567fbf74953038ec89c5ca56f48049674e21bb55
confirmations
358168
spent
true